About This Speed Converter

This speed converter changes values between common speed units including kilometres per hour, miles per hour, metres per second, knots, and feet per second.

It is useful for travel, running and cycling, aviation and marine references, physics problems, and checking speed figures from different countries or systems.

The converter uses fixed unit relationships, so it is best for unit conversion rather than predicting real travel time with stops, traffic, or changing speed.

Speed Conversion Example

100 km/h is about 62.14 mph. A speed of 10 m/s is 36 km/h, which is useful when comparing physics values with road or sport speeds.

For travel planning, remember that converted speed is only the moving speed. Real journey time also depends on stops, route conditions, acceleration, and traffic.

Frequently Asked Questions

What is the difference between km/h and mph?

They measure the same concept in different systems. 1 km/h is about 0.621 mph, which is why road speeds look numerically smaller in mph at the same real speed.

When would I use knots?

Knots are common in aviation and marine contexts. Converting knots to km/h or mph helps compare with road or land-based references.

Does this predict travel time?

No. It converts speed units only. Journey time also depends on distance, stops, and average speed over the whole route.
